博客 能源指标平台建设:微服务架构与实时数据采集方案

能源指标平台建设:微服务架构与实时数据采集方案

   数栈君   发表于 2026-03-28 10:47  45  0

能源指标平台建设:微服务架构与实时数据采集方案

在“双碳”目标驱动下,能源管理正从粗放式向精细化、智能化加速转型。企业亟需构建一套高效、可扩展、高可用的能源指标平台,以实现对电力、燃气、热力、水耗等多源能耗数据的统一采集、实时分析与可视化决策。能源指标平台建设不再是可选的IT项目,而是企业实现绿色运营、降低碳足迹、提升能效竞争力的核心基础设施。

🔹 为什么需要微服务架构?

传统单体架构的能源系统常面临扩展性差、部署周期长、故障影响范围大等问题。当企业新增光伏电站、储能系统或智能电表时,系统往往需要整体重构,导致成本飙升、上线延迟。

微服务架构通过将平台拆分为多个独立部署、松耦合的服务单元,从根本上解决了这些问题:

  • 独立部署与弹性伸缩:数据采集服务、指标计算服务、告警服务、可视化服务可独立升级与扩缩容。例如,在用电高峰期间,可单独扩容数据采集服务,而不影响告警模块运行。
  • 技术异构性支持:不同服务可采用最适合的技术栈。采集层使用Python+MQTT处理低功耗设备协议,计算层采用Flink实现实时流处理,前端使用React构建交互式仪表盘。
  • 容错与隔离:若某区域的温湿度传感器数据采集服务异常,仅影响该区域,不会导致整个平台崩溃。
  • 敏捷开发与持续交付:各团队可并行开发不同服务,通过CI/CD流水线实现每日多次发布,加速功能迭代。

在能源指标平台中,典型微服务包括:

  • 设备接入服务:支持Modbus、OPC UA、MQTT、HTTP等协议,适配不同品牌电表、水表、气表。
  • 数据清洗服务:剔除异常值、填补缺失点、统一时间戳。
  • 指标计算服务:按小时/日/月计算单位产值能耗、PUE、单位产品电耗等KPI。
  • 告警引擎服务:基于规则引擎(如Drools)触发阈值告警、趋势异常、设备离线等事件。
  • API网关服务:统一认证、限流、路由,为前端、BI系统、第三方平台提供标准化接口。
  • 元数据管理服务:维护设备拓扑、计量单位、计算公式、组织权限等配置信息。

🔹 实时数据采集:从“每隔5分钟”到“每秒1000点”

能源数据采集的实时性直接决定平台的决策价值。过去依赖SCADA系统每5分钟轮询一次的模式,已无法满足动态负荷预测、需求响应、碳排核算等场景。

现代能源指标平台必须实现亚秒级实时采集,核心方案包括:

边缘计算节点部署在厂区、变电站、楼宇部署轻量级边缘网关(如华为Atlas、研华WISE-PaaS),本地完成协议解析、数据预处理与缓存。即使网络中断,边缘节点仍可存储24小时数据,待恢复后自动补传,保障数据完整性。

协议适配与多通道并发支持同时接入20+种工业协议,并行处理数千个设备点位。例如,一个大型制造园区可能包含:

  • 1200台智能电表(Modbus TCP)
  • 300个温湿度传感器(LoRaWAN)
  • 50个燃气流量计(OPC UA)
  • 20个光伏逆变器(MQTT over TLS)

采用异步I/O模型(如Netty)与连接池技术,单节点可稳定支撑5000+点位并发采集,延迟控制在200ms以内。

时序数据库选型传统关系型数据库(如MySQL)无法高效存储高频时序数据。推荐使用专为时序数据设计的数据库:

  • InfluxDB:高写入吞吐,支持标签索引,适合中小规模部署。
  • TDengine:国产开源,压缩率高达10:1,单机每秒写入百万点,支持SQL查询,适合大规模工业场景。
  • ClickHouse:列式存储,适合复杂聚合分析,但写入延迟略高。

在平台架构中,采集数据先写入Kafka消息队列,再由消费者写入时序数据库,形成“采集→缓冲→持久化”三层解耦结构,提升系统鲁棒性。

📊 实时数据可视化:让能耗“看得见、管得住”

采集是基础,可视化是价值出口。能源指标平台的可视化模块需满足:

  • 多维度钻取:从集团→工厂→车间→设备四级穿透,支持按时间、区域、产品线筛选。
  • 动态刷新:仪表盘每秒刷新,展示实时功率曲线、累计能耗、碳排放强度。
  • 自定义看板:允许用户拖拽组件,组合柱状图、热力图、拓扑图、雷达图等。
  • 移动端适配:支持微信小程序、APP端查看关键指标,实现“掌上能源管理”。

典型可视化场景包括:

  • 📈 实时功率曲线图:展示全厂15分钟内用电波动,识别非生产时段异常耗电。
  • 🔥 碳排放热力图:按车间颜色深浅显示单位产值碳排强度,辅助减排优先级排序。
  • 🧭 设备健康拓扑图:以图形化方式呈现设备连接关系,红黄绿状态标识运行健康度。
  • 📊 能效对标雷达图:对比不同产线单位产品电耗,识别标杆与短板。

所有可视化组件均通过RESTful API从后端服务获取数据,前端采用ECharts或D3.js实现高性能渲染,避免页面卡顿。

🔹 数据中台赋能:统一标准,打破数据孤岛

能源指标平台不是孤立系统,它必须与ERP、MES、CMMS、碳管理平台等系统打通。这依赖于数据中台的支撑:

  • 统一数据模型:定义“设备—计量点—指标—单位—时间粒度”标准模型,确保跨系统数据语义一致。
  • 元数据管理:记录每个指标的计算逻辑(如:PUE = 总能耗 / IT设备能耗)、数据来源、更新频率。
  • 数据血缘追踪:当某项指标异常时,可追溯其原始数据来自哪台设备、经过哪些清洗规则、由哪个服务计算得出。
  • 数据服务化:将常用指标封装为API服务(如 /api/energy/kpi?plant=001&period=day),供其他系统调用,避免重复开发。

数据中台使能源指标平台成为企业数字化的“能源中枢”,而非又一个烟囱系统。

🔹 数字孪生:从“数据展示”到“模拟推演”

在高级阶段,能源指标平台可升级为数字孪生系统:

  • 构建厂区3D模型,将真实设备与虚拟模型绑定。
  • 实时映射设备运行状态(温度、振动、能耗)。
  • 模拟“关闭A生产线”对全厂能耗的影响。
  • 预测“新增光伏装机”对碳排的削减效果。

数字孪生不是炫技,而是预测性决策工具。例如,某汽车厂通过数字孪生模拟发现:在电价谷段提前启动空压机,可节省17%电费。该方案经平台验证后,直接下发至PLC执行。

🔹 架构落地的关键实践

  1. 分阶段建设:先试点1个车间,验证采集精度与指标准确性,再推广至全厂。
  2. 安全合规:工业网络需部署防火墙、VPN、设备身份认证(如证书+MAC绑定),符合等保2.0三级要求。
  3. 成本控制:优先选用开源组件(如TDengine、Kafka、Prometheus),降低授权成本。
  4. 运维监控:为每个微服务部署Prometheus+Grafana监控指标,实现自动告警与日志聚合。

🔹 为什么选择云原生部署?

现代能源指标平台建议部署于Kubernetes集群,实现:

  • 自动扩缩容:夜间低谷自动缩容,白天高峰自动扩容。
  • 服务发现与负载均衡:无需手动配置IP。
  • 滚动更新:新版本上线不影响业务连续性。

云原生架构显著降低运维复杂度,提升系统可用性至99.95%以上。

🔹 结语:能源指标平台建设是数字化转型的必选项

能源指标平台建设不是一次性的项目,而是一项持续演进的战略工程。它连接设备、数据、算法与决策,是企业实现“碳中和”目标的技术底座。

无论是制造、化工、物流还是数据中心,谁率先构建起高效、实时、智能的能源指标平台,谁就能在能耗成本、政策合规、品牌形象上建立长期优势。

现在,是时候评估您的能源管理现状了。申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s申请试用&https://www.dtstack.com/?src=bbs

通过专业平台,您可快速接入设备、配置指标、生成报表,无需从零开发。节省6-12个月开发周期,让您的能源管理,从“被动响应”走向“主动优化”。

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料